Pulse Analysis

Enterprises today grapple with volatile workloads that can degrade database responsiveness, forcing costly manual tuning. Oracle 26ai tackles this challenge by embedding automation—automatic transaction rollback and real‑time SQL plan management—directly into the engine. These features detect and remediate performance anomalies before they impact users, aligning with a broader industry shift toward self‑healing data platforms that free DBA resources for strategic initiatives.

The inclusion of Oracle AI Vector Search marks a significant move toward in‑database artificial intelligence. By storing vector embeddings and executing similarity searches inside the database, organizations eliminate the latency and security risks of shuttling data to external AI services. This architecture not only speeds up use cases such as recommendation engines and fraud detection but also leverages existing Oracle security controls—encryption, auditing, and role‑based access—ensuring compliance while simplifying AI adoption.

Beyond performance and AI, 26ai modernizes data ingestion and storage. Fast Ingest accelerates batch and real‑time loads for partitioned, compressed, and in‑memory tables, supporting event‑driven analytics pipelines. The new True Cache provides a database‑aware, self‑managed memory layer that boosts read throughput without the operational overhead of external caches. Coupled with shrink‑tablespace capabilities that reclaim unused space, the release helps control storage costs and eases capacity planning, making Oracle 26ai a compelling foundation for cloud‑native, hybrid, and containerized environments.
